Understanding Cloud Infrastructure Skills
Cloud infrastructure skills form the backbone of modern DevOps practices. As organizations increasingly migrate to cloud-based environments, it’s essential to grasp the intricacies of platforms like AWS, Azure, and Google Cloud Platform. Understanding concepts such as compute, storage, and network resources is fundamental.
Moreover, professionals should be proficient in cloud service models, including IaaS, PaaS, and SaaS. This knowledge enables DevOps engineers to design scalable, reliable, and cost-effective solutions that meet their organization’s needs while ensuring optimal performance.
Technical expertise in managing cloud infrastructure often incorporates skills in scripting, automation, and tools like Terraform and Ansible to implement Infrastructure as Code (IaC). These proficiencies allow teams to automate repetitive tasks, improve deployment speed, and foster collaboration across departments.
Mastering CI/CD Pipelines
Continuous Integration and Continuous Deployment (CI/CD) pipelines are at the heart of effective DevOps practices. Professionals must understand how to build, test, and deploy applications efficiently using CI/CD frameworks that reduce the risk of errors.
To establish robust CI/CD pipelines, knowledge of tools such as Jenkins, GitLab CI, and CircleCI is vital. These tools facilitate automated testing and deployment processes, allowing developers to focus on writing clean code while application updates roll out smoothly.
Additionally, understanding how to manage version control through Git and other VCS systems is important. This foundational skill ensures that teams can collaborate effectively, track changes, and maintain code integrity throughout the development lifecycle.
Container Orchestration: A Game-Changer
With the rise of microservices architecture, container orchestration has become a crucial skill for DevOps practitioners. Understanding how to manage containerized applications using tools like Kubernetes, Docker Swarm, or Amazon ECS is essential for maintaining the scalability and availability of services.
Container orchestration simplifies deployment and management processes, allowing businesses to achieve greater efficiency and reliability. Skills in this area include setting up clusters, managing service discovery, load balancing, and effectively scaling applications in response to demand.
By mastering container orchestration, DevOps teams can ensure a streamlined workflow, swift deployments, and increased uptime, leading to higher user satisfaction and enhanced business outcomes.
Monitoring and Incident Response
No DevOps strategy is complete without effective monitoring and incident response capabilities. Understanding how to leverage monitoring tools like Prometheus, Grafana, and ELK Stack is vital for capturing metrics and logs that inform decision-making.
Proactive monitoring will allow teams to identify issues before they escalate into critical incidents, ensuring minimal downtime. Furthermore, crafting response plans for potential incidents can significantly improve an organization’s ability to handle emergencies swiftly and efficiently.
Training in incident response exercises and post-mortem analyses cultivates a culture of continuous improvement, helping teams learn from past incidents and avoid repeating mistakes.
Security Scanning in DevOps
As cyber threats continue to evolve, incorporating security scanning within the DevOps pipeline is non-negotiable. DevSecOps emphasizes the integration of security practices at every stage of the development process, shifting security left to catch vulnerabilities early.
Knowledge of tools like Snyk, Aqua Security, and OWASP ZAP for scanning images and code for vulnerabilities is imperative. DevOps professionals should be equipped to ensure that all components of their applications are secure, adhering to compliance and regulatory standards while maintaining performance.
Adopting a proactive security stance not only protects sensitive data but also enhances client trust and satisfaction in your products or services.
Optimizing Deployment Workflows
Finally, a thorough understanding of deployment workflows is crucial for successful DevOps practices. This includes knowledge of blue-green deployments, canary releases, and rolling updates, which help minimize downtime and reduce the impact of potential failures during deployment.
By optimizing these workflows, teams can ensure quicker iterations and more reliable release cycles. Streamlining these processes often requires collaboration across teams and a shared understanding of the deployment process, reducing friction during releases.
Furthermore, having a solid grasp of release management tools and practices is crucial for tracking progress, ensuring team accountability, and aligning development with business goals.
